#b6274c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b6274c is composed of 71.4% red, 15.3%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.6% magenta, 58.2%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 344.5 degrees, a saturation of 64.7% and a lightness of 43.3%. #b6274c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4e98 with #6d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#b6274c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b6274c has RGB values of R:182, G:39,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.58,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11937612.

Shades and Tints of #b6274c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040102 is the darkest color, while #fcf3f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b6274c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#726b6d is the less saturated color, while #d8053c is the most saturated one.
